    The no-tip mug is brilliant. How it works is pretty simple. Notice that if you pull straight up on it, the body separates slightly from the bottom. There's a suction cup at the absolute bottom that's probably silicone, so very flexible, much sticky. At the top of the suction cup is a valve. When you lift up on the top, the valve opens and lets air in, preventing the suction cup from acting as one. If you push from the side, the top is still sealed, so you are generating a vacuum, which keeps it from falling over. A great gadget. Would have to have very tight tolerances to work properly. Which it appears to. Whenever you two knocked it over, it was because it was smacked in a way that the top half was lifted up, thus letting air to pass into the vacuum cup. Still, I don't see it being much practical in a huge size like that. Dashboard size, yes. Or if you're a massive clutz who always spills the drink on their desktop.
